Major attractions in Liechtenstein

Vaduz - The capital is one of the famous places in Liechtenstein that boasts in some of the most amazing spots. The postage stamp museum, National Library and the Ski museum are worth visiting. It is a land of cathedrals and many other famous heritage buildings.

Vaduz is popular for its large shopping centers that offer some of the exquisite stores for picking gifts and enjoying dining options.

Balzers - The least visited spots in Liechtenstein that makes it the most untouched beauty of Europe. Explore the nature's best landscapes, wildlife and meadows that are simply breathtaking experience.

It is a very scantly populated place with only 4000 inhabitants. It has one very famous educational institute in Haus Gutenberg. Other famous spots are the Mariahilf Chapel and the St. Peter's Chapel. It is with the campanile and is with the Parish Church that has one of the oldest towers.

Liechtenstein spots worth visiting -

Regierungsgebaude - This is one of the oldest government buildings and was established in the 1905. It is the center for the Parliament and also one of the Liechtenstein places to visit.

The building is a landmark of the capital city Vaduz. The construction prides in claiming the sovereignty of the country and for being the legendary building of Vaduz which is the capital since 1342. It is also the residence of the lords of the ancient properties of Vaduz and also of the Principality of Liechtenstein.

Ruins of Schellenberg - This region of Liechtenstein was populated in 3,000 BC. It is located high on the Rhine valley and dates back in the 13th century. The establishment was primarily owned by the lords of southern Germany and from them only the name Schellenberg came into existence.
